I’ve had the Back Buddy for over a year now, and it’s been totally worth it. I keep it next to my nightstand and do my back and shoulders before stretching and going to sleep. Once you get the hang of it, you can leverage quite a lot of strength and direct it exactly to those hard-to-reach spots. I like a ton of pressure when I get massages, and this is a tool that lets me do that for myself. It’s not a substitute for a really great massage therapist, but for the money, I feel like it’s paid for itself many times over. Combined with a little light yoga stretches, this releases enough tension from my back and shoulders that I actually do sleep better.
I’ve found that I almost exclusively use the single knob in the middle, directed at/around my shoulder blades (with lots of pressure) and even up the side of my neck (with less pressure). I haven’t found the other knobs as useful. The ends of the S don’t let me really dig in, so I basically ignore them. That’s OK by me.
The mini version is pretty useless for me. I even tossed mine when I was moving apartments and getting rid of junk. I feel that the value of the regular-sized BB is in allowing you to grab both ends and DIG (did I mention I really need a lot of pressure for my knots?), and the little one offered zero leverage and was too short to get to the middle of my back where I need it. It might work for others, but not for me. The large one is so much better that I’ve even been tempted to pack it in a suitcase on plane trips, though it IS pretty unwieldy so I haven’t actually done that yet.
